mirror of
https://github.com/versia-pub/server.git
synced 2026-01-26 04:06:01 +01:00
feat(api): ✨ Add banner attribute to instance metadata endpoints (v1 and v2)
This commit is contained in:
parent
1b7b71eaec
commit
03750d5e86
|
|
@ -109,6 +109,7 @@ export default apiRoute(async (req, matchedRoute, extraData) => {
|
|||
user_count: userCount,
|
||||
},
|
||||
thumbnail: config.instance.logo,
|
||||
banner: config.instance.banner,
|
||||
title: config.instance.name,
|
||||
uri: config.http.base_url,
|
||||
urls: {
|
||||
|
|
@ -186,6 +187,7 @@ export default apiRoute(async (req, matchedRoute, extraData) => {
|
|||
},
|
||||
contact_account: contactAccount?.toAPI() || undefined,
|
||||
} satisfies APIInstance & {
|
||||
banner: string;
|
||||
pleroma: object;
|
||||
});
|
||||
});
|
||||
|
|
|
|||
|
|
@ -63,6 +63,9 @@ export default apiRoute(async (req, matchedRoute, extraData) => {
|
|||
thumbnail: {
|
||||
url: config.instance.logo,
|
||||
},
|
||||
banner: {
|
||||
url: config.instance.banner,
|
||||
},
|
||||
languages: ["en"],
|
||||
configuration: {
|
||||
urls: {
|
||||
|
|
|
|||
Loading…
Reference in a new issue